    Under the influence of water currents (and wind if the top buoy is above the sea surface) the shape of the mooring line can be determined and by this the actual depth of the instruments. [8] [9] If the currents are strong (above 0.1 m/s) and the mooring lines are long (more than 1 km), the instrument position may vary up to 50 m.

    The investigation concluded that the buoy's hull size was of insufficient length to be moored in 3,600 feet (1,097 m) of water. To support such a mooring, a similarly shaped hull had to be 20 feet (6.1 m) long and displace approximately 20,000 pounds (9,072 kg). This was to become the prototype of the buoy now known as the NOMAD. [2]

    A rope made of floating synthetics such as polypropylene attaches to the mooring and in turn attaches to a buoy. The buoy can float at the surface (lasting 3–4 years) or lie subsurface to avoid detection and surface hazards such as weather and ship traffic.
